NAME
       Class::MOP::Object - Base class for metaclasses

VERSION
       version 2.2009

DESCRIPTION
       This class is a very minimal base class for metaclasses.

METHODS
       This class provides a few methods which are useful in all metaclasses.

   Class::MOP::???->meta
       This returns a Class::MOP::Class object.

   $metaobject->dump($max_depth)
       This method uses Data::Dumper to dump the object. You can pass an
       optional maximum depth, which will set $Data::Dumper::Maxdepth. The
       default maximum depth is 1.

   $metaclass->throw_error($message)
       This method calls "_throw_exception" in Class::MOP::Mixin internally,
       with an object of class Moose::Exception::Legacy.
